So I planted 5 seeds about 2 weeks ago now in 7g fabric pots, 2 of them are doing better then the others. I’m using pro mix cc. Was giving them purified water with a 5.8 ph ..2 days ago I hit em with the first taste of nutrients (using Diablo nutrient line) not sure if there stunted or what but the other 3 are just super slow moving and that 1 inparticular
Plants that young do not need nutrients. You are probably burning them up.
 
I also grow in soil, and as a guide to help, you should raise your ph. somewhere between 6-7 in soil. Here is a chart to show you how plants need to be in the right ph for your medium so that the plant can uptake the nutrients in your soil. As the above comment suggests, the soil should have enough nutrients for a while for those small plants. Also, raise your lights on these small girls so they don't get stressed 👍...and don't over water/ feed in these large pots.

At that stage, the seedling needs nothing but water, no nutes, the soil contains all it needs right now. The root enhancer or compost tea is an awesome idea, i did it 1st week in veg and when i transplanted 21days later the roots looked like spider man was down there building a house 😂....i burned my plant at that stage youre in by having it too close to the leaves. Raise the light and water the whole pot SLOWLY! Dont add too much....im in gal fabric pots also so I can guage what ya got goin on...i was adding 1 20oz bottle of water SLOWLY sprayed into soil for the plant that young. Now at almost 70days of veg shes using about a gallon every 2 to 3 days depending on if i have C02 running or not. Less water is better but it has to remotely saturate soil bc the roots will not grow into dry medium.
